While at first in any type of drug rehab in Odin, individuals who are just recently abstaining from alcohol and drugs are detoxed and ideally assisted through this, with withdrawal made a bit easier with the assistance of detox professionals. Despite someone is detoxed however, they are still likely to encounter intense cravings to drink or use drugs, cravings which may persist for a long time. A lot of people claim that they experience such cravings throughout their lives, but ideally cope through them with the life tools and effective coping methods they obtain in an effective Odin, MN. drug rehab. Also, short-term drug rehab in Odin, MN. which offers rehab for thirty days or less are really the least ideal rehab settings even when receiving inpatient or residential treatment. As stated earlier, those who have recently abstained from alcohol need a substantial amount of time to recover physically and really stabilize from the dependence brought on by their substance abuse. After only a few weeks, individuals in drug rehab in Odin, Minnesota are just becoming accustomed to a drug free lifestyle, and figuring out how to adjust physically, mentally, and emotionally without their drug of choice. This leaves almost no time for them to clearly focus on what can actually enable them to keep a drug free and healthy way of life after they return home, and this will take quite some time for those who may need to make significant and life changing choices and changes in lifestyle.

Long-term drug rehab in Odin is a perfect rehab option for various reasons, but it offers the required change of environment and also the intensity of treatment needed for individuals who want to reap all the rewards of treatment and be able to sustain these gains whenever they return home to their normal lives. Long-term drug rehab in Odin, MN. is provided in either an inpatient or residential treatment center, with the principal differences being inpatient offers rehabilitation services in case you make require hospital services as part of their treatment process. This might be true for a person who's experiencing a physical ailment or life threatening disease which has been worsened due to their substance abuse, or someone who may require help being weaned from prescription drugs which they have become dependent to.
